If you choose to fill out a bill of sale, the following information is needed:A description of the vehicle (make, model, year)Vehicle identification number (VIN)Warranty information.Final sale price.Names of the buyer and seller.The county and state where the vehicle was bought or sold.
The seller must title a vehicle in his or her name before the vehicle can be sold. Never buy a vehicle without a title--you will not be able to register it! Michigan Law requires disclosure of the actual odometer reading at the time of transfer or assignment of the vehicle's title.
The State of Michigan requires a bill of sale, among other documentation, upon transferring a vehicle's title and registration from a previous owner to a new one. The form stipulates the vehicle's purchase price, condition, and any additional terms set by the agreeing parties.

If you are selling your vehicle and cannot find its title, you will need to get a duplicate title at a Secretary of State branch office. As seller, complete your part on the title assignment by signing it and adding the: Vehicle mileage. Selling date.
